APF51

l'APF51, une carte électronique (SBC ARM9) linux embarqué et son FPGA Xilinx

Description

L'APF51 est une carte à microprocesseur de taille réduite bénéficiant d'un rapport coût/performance extrêmement compétitif.

Equipée d'un microprocesseur i.MX515 (ARM Cortex A8) à 800MHz, de 256 Mo RAM DDR Low Power, de 512 Mo de FLASH SLC NAND, d'un port Ethernet 10/100Mbits, de deux USB High Speed et d'un USB OTG, elle est facilement intégrable dans un système embarqué grâce notamment à ses régulateurs et ses convertisseurs de niveau (PHY RS232/USB/Ethernet).

Comme d'habitude chez Armadeus systems, cette carte est équipée d'un FPGA, ici un Spartan 6A XC6SLX9, ce qui augmente considérablement les fonctionalités matérielles du module.

Remarque : aucun debugger externe (BDI, JTAG) n'est requis. Une simple liaison RS232 est suffisante pour des développements "faibles coûts". Un debugger Linux est disponible (GDB).


Version V2 (Voir le datasheet pour les détails sur compatibilité avec la version V1)

Microprocesseur

  • i.MX515 @ 800 MHz (Freescale):
    ARM Cortex A8 avec cache 32KB I et D cache, 256KB L2 ainsi qu'une FPU

RAM

  • 256/512 Mo 32 bits Low Power DDR (64 à 512 MB en option pour des volumes)

Flash

  • 512 Mo SLC NAND (jusqu'à 4 GB en option pour des volumes)

Périphériques

  • 3 x UARTs
  • 2 x I2C
  • 3 x SPI
  • 2 x SSI (Port série synchrone rapide)
  • 1 x USB OTG avec PHY
  • 2 x USB Host (Hi-Speed) avec PHY
  • 1 x reseau 10/100 Mbits avec PHY et autoMDX
  • 1 x SD/MMC
  • 1 x RTC avec batterie
  • 2 x PWM résolution 16bits
  • 1 x Keypad (8x8)
  • 1 x Contrôleur vidéo STN/TFT jusqu'à 1920 x 1080 px, 24 bits
  • 1 x contrôleur de dalle tactile (4/5 fils)
  • 1 x CSI (interface capteur vidéo CMOS)
  • 1 x codec MPEG/H.264
  • 1 x OPEN GL/VG (accélérateur 2D/3D)
  • 1 x accélérateur crytographique
  • 4 x entrées analogiques 12 bits
  • Jusqu'à 34 Entrés/Sorties (GPIOs)
  • 1 x oneWire
  • 1 x identificateur unique (Unique ID)
  • 1 x WatchDog
  • 1 x port de debug JTAG (ICE)

FPGA

  • Xilinx Spartan 6A XC6SLX9 (sans FPGA ou versions XC6SLX4 à XC6SLX16 possibles en option pour des volumes)
  • Jusqu'à 15 paires différentielles
  • Jusqu'à 15 sorties en courant
  • Jusqu'à 34 Entrés/Sorties (GPIO)

Alimentation

  • Alimentation +5V DC
  • 1 x superviseur de température et d'alimentation intégrée (PMIC)
  • 1 x chargeur/superviseur de batteries 1A (Li-Ion/LiPo) avec status sur GPIOs

Environnement

  • Refroidissement: aucun pour des températures inférieures à 60°C *.
  • Température d'utilisation: -20°C..75°C * (-45 à + 85°C en option pour des volumes)
  • Température de stockage: -45°C..+85°C
  • Humidité 5-90%
    * : dépend de l'utilisation du FPGA.

Mécanique

  • Dimensions: 58mm (2.3") x 58mm (2.3")
  • Connecteurs: 2 x Hirose 140pins fine pitch (0.5mm). Connecteur réf: FX8-140P-SV1(91)

ROHS

  • Oui

Système d'exploitation embarqué

  • Linux 2.6.38 ou supérieur

La carte est livrée avec UBoot et Linux préprogrammés

Produits

Ressources

Documentation

Fichiers pré-compilés

Kits de développement

 
 
  • Accueil
  • Produits
  • Services
  • Support
  • Références
  • Société
  • Acheter
  • Contact
  • Actualités
  • Plan du site
  • Mentions légales
  • © 2015 armadeus systems. - Concepteur de systèmes Linux embarqués.
    Tous droits réservés.